Detailed Description
Type 2 diabetes (T2DM) is an increasingly common illness that is linked to considerable excessive mortality. There are many indications that treatment of raised blood pressure and blood glucose as well as dyslipidaemia can postpone the development of diabetic complications. Treatment of T2DM is primarily done in general practice, where the results are not satisfactory. The purpose of the project is to create a basis so the existing research-based knowledge can be used to improve the quality of diabetes care in general practice.
The answer will be based on the information from 1,428 newly diagnosed diabetic patients aged 40 or over who were followed since 1989 in a randomised trial among more than 600 general practitioners. The intervention, which ended at the beginning of 1996, provided optimum conditions for follow-up, doctor-patient communication and treatment, among other ways by training the doctors, producing clinical guidelines and setting individual treatment goals. In the project, the general practitioner is seen as the coordinator of the whole health system's prophylactic efforts in relation to the individual diabetic patient.
The aims of a concluding 14-year follow-up are:
- To investigate what long-term effect the project model for structured, personalized diabetes care has on 1) the patients' mortality and development of diabetic complications, 2) the patients' use of services from the primary and secondary sector, 3) the patients' self-rated health and motivation, and 4) the doctor-patient relationship.

Inclusion Criteria:
- all patients aged 40 or older with newly diagnosed diabetes between 1 March 1989 and 28 February 1991 based on hyperglycaemic symptoms or raised blood glucose values measured in general practice
Exclusion Criteria:
- threatening somatic disease, severe mental illness, or unwillingness to participate. For our analysis, we also excluded non-white patients and patients whose diagnosis was not established by a blood glucose measurement at a major laboratory within 500 days after diagnosis.

No Intervention: Routine general practice care
In the comparison group, doctors were free to choose any treatment and change it over time.
The study coordinating centre did not contact comparison practices after the end of recruitment (late 1991) until 1995.
|
General practitioners (GPs) were recommended to perform regular follow up every three months and an annual screening for diabetic complications.
The GP was requested to define, together with the patient, the best possible goals for blood glucose concentration, glycated haemoglobin (HbA1c), diastolic blood pressure, and lipids within three predefined categories.
At each quarterly consultation, the GP was asked to compare the achievements with the goal and consider changing either goal or treatment accordingly.
The doctors received annual descriptive feedback reports on individual patients.
The GPs were introduced to possible solutions to therapeutic problems through clinical guidelines supported by an annual half day seminar.
Patient leaflets were produced for the doctor to hand out.
